Keys The BMW Digital Key system is an easy way to gain access to your vehicle. It makes use of your smartphone as a key fob, permitting you to open, start, and lock the car with it. Additionally it comes with a number of security and safety features to safeguard your vehicle from theft. Download the BMW Connected App and follow the instructions on the screen to configure the Digital Key. Connect your compatible iPhone to your vehicle using the USB cable. Alternately, you can utilize the Digital Key plug for a wireless connection. Once you've successfully paired your phone, you are able to remove it from the smartphone tray. If you're ready to share your Digital Key, navigate to the BMW Connected app and select "Digital Key". Select the "Invite Guest" option, then enter the email address of a friend and then customize access permissions and duration. The recipient will receive an invitation via iMessage. You can monitor their progress by visiting the Digital Key section in the BMW Connected App. After accepting your invitation, the guest will need to download the BMW Connected App and link it to their BMW ID. The guest will also have to activate their Digital Key and verify their identity using fingerprints or BMWID. Remote start systems use a control module that receives signals from your key fob using unique radio frequencies. This allows you to remotely start your car and even lock it from the comfort at home. Many systems can be linked to smartphone apps, which provide additional features such as push notifications as well as vehicle status and an extended range. Compustar's DroneMobile app, for example, provides intuitive control over aspects like setting the temperature. Once you've re-started your car using the remote start feature, it will continue running until a person who has an authentic key fob is allowed to enter the vehicle. This ensures that your vehicle isn't stolen while you're working or on the go. The majority of RES will shut down the car's engine when you don't get into the vehicle for a certain period of time. While there are numerous benefits of having a remote starter, it's important to understand its limitations as well. If you begin your car while located in a tiny space, such as an office parking lot or garage, exhaust fumes can quickly fill the area. Additionally, some remote starts may not be compatible with manual transmission models or other features specific to the model.
